系统属性“ org.apache.coyote.http11.Http11Protocol.SERVER”的默认值从此处设置为“ Apache-Coyote / 1.1”

时间:2019-03-22 04:23:41

标签: tomcat jboss7.x

我试图从响应标头中隐藏服务器名称“ Server:Apache-Coyote / 1.1”,但我们不能像强制标头那样。只有我们才能将org.apache.coyote.http11.Http11Protocol.SERVER的值重命名为任何值。

在JBOSS中,我们可以在standalone.xml中将此属性作为属性覆盖

<属性名=“ =” org.apache.coyote.http11.Http11Protocol.SERVER“ value =” SecureServer“ />

但是我的问题是,实际上在哪里定义或设置此系统属性“ org.apache.coyote.http11.Http11Protocol.SERVER”为默认值?

我检查了源代码https://github.com/apache/tomcat,但找不到我们要设置为默认值的位置。

0 个答案:

没有答案